There has been a requirement (loosely enforced lately) for passengers from some countries, including the US and Canada to have a negative Covid test to enter Portugal.

As of today (July 1st) that requirement is revoked.

As of July 1, 2022, passengers entering national territory are no longer required to present proof of carrying out a test to screen for SARS-CoV-2 infection with a negative result or to present a COVID-EU digital certificate or vaccination or recovery certificate issued by third countries, accepted or recognized in Portugal.
